• Home
  • Cloud VPS
    • Hong Kong VPS
    • US VPS
  • Dedicated Servers
    • Hong Kong Servers
    • US Servers
    • Singapore Servers
    • Japan Servers
  • Company
    • Contact Us
    • Blog
logo logo
  • Home
  • Cloud VPS
    • Hong Kong VPS
    • US VPS
  • Dedicated Servers
    • Hong Kong Servers
    • US Servers
    • Singapore Servers
    • Japan Servers
  • Company
    • Contact Us
    • Blog
ENEN
  • 简体简体
  • 繁體繁體
Client Area

IIS Security Tip: Configure file and directory permissions carefully

December 18, 2023

IIS Security Tip: Configure file and directory permissions carefully

When it comes to hosting a website, security should always be a top priority. One crucial aspect of securing your website is configuring file and directory permissions correctly. In this article, we will explore the importance of file and directory permissions in IIS (Internet Information Services) and provide tips on how to configure them carefully.

Understanding File and Directory Permissions

File and directory permissions control who can access, modify, and execute files and directories on a web server. In the context of IIS, these permissions determine what actions users can perform on your website’s files and directories.

There are three primary types of permissions:

  • Read: Allows users to view the contents of a file or directory.
  • Write: Permits users to modify or create new files and directories.
  • Execute: Enables users to run scripts or execute programs.

Each permission can be granted or denied to different user groups, such as the website owner, administrators, or anonymous users.

The Importance of Careful Configuration

Configuring file and directory permissions carefully is crucial for several reasons:

1. Protecting Sensitive Data

Proper permissions ensure that sensitive data, such as configuration files or user databases, are only accessible to authorized individuals. By restricting access to these files, you minimize the risk of unauthorized access or data breaches.

2. Preventing Unauthorized Modifications

Incorrect permissions can allow malicious users to modify or delete critical files, leading to website malfunctions or even complete compromise. By setting appropriate permissions, you can prevent unauthorized modifications and maintain the integrity of your website.

3. Mitigating Cross-Site Scripting (XSS) Attacks

By carefully configuring permissions, you can limit the execution of scripts or programs to trusted sources only. This helps mitigate the risk of cross-site scripting attacks, where malicious scripts are injected into web pages to steal sensitive information or perform unauthorized actions.

Tips for Configuring File and Directory Permissions

Follow these tips to ensure you configure file and directory permissions carefully:

1. Principle of Least Privilege

Adhere to the principle of least privilege, granting users only the permissions necessary to perform their tasks. Avoid giving excessive permissions that could potentially be exploited by attackers.

2. Regularly Review and Update Permissions

Regularly review and update file and directory permissions to account for changes in your website’s structure or user roles. Remove unnecessary permissions and ensure that new files and directories inherit the correct permissions.

3. Use Strong Authentication and Authorization

Implement strong authentication and authorization mechanisms to control access to your website’s files and directories. Utilize features such as Windows Authentication or role-based access control (RBAC) to enforce granular permissions.

4. Protect Configuration Files

Configuration files often contain sensitive information, such as database credentials or API keys. Ensure that these files are stored outside the web root directory and have restricted permissions to prevent unauthorized access.

5. Regularly Backup and Monitor

Regularly backup your website’s files and directories to mitigate the impact of any security incidents. Additionally, implement monitoring mechanisms to detect any unauthorized access attempts or suspicious activities.

Conclusion

Configuring file and directory permissions carefully is a critical aspect of securing your website hosted on IIS. By following the tips mentioned in this article, you can protect sensitive data, prevent unauthorized modifications, and mitigate the risk of attacks. Take the necessary steps to ensure your website’s security and provide a safe browsing experience for your users.

For more information on Server.HK and our reliable VPS hosting solutions, visit server.hk.

Recent Posts

  • Hong Kong VPS vs Google Cloud Asia: Which Delivers Better China Performance in 2026?
  • Why No-ICP-Filing Hong Kong Hosting Is the Smart Choice for Cross-Border E-Commerce
  • Hong Kong VPS vs AWS Hong Kong Region: Cost, Latency, and Control Compared
  • Data Privacy Laws in Hong Kong: What VPS Users Need to Know
  • Hong Kong VPS Security Checklist: 10 Steps to Harden Your Server in 2026

Recent Comments

  1. metoprolol generic on Hong Kong VPS vs Japan VPS: Head-to-Head for Asia-Pacific Deployments in 2026
  2. levitra price on Top 5 Use Cases for a Hong Kong Dedicated Server in 2026
  3. finasterid on Hong Kong VPS vs Singapore VPS: Which Is Better for Your Asia Business in 2026?
  4. doxycycline hyclate 100mg on How to Set Up a WordPress Site on a Hong Kong VPS with aaPanel (Step-by-Step 2026)
  5. ciprofloxacin 500 mg tablet on How to Choose the Right Hong Kong VPS Plan: A Buyer’s Guide for 2026

Knowledge Base

Access detailed guides, tutorials, and resources.

Live Chat

Get instant help 24/7 from our support team.

Send Ticket

Our team typically responds within 10 minutes.

logo
Alipay Cc-paypal Cc-stripe Cc-visa Cc-mastercard Bitcoin
Cloud VPS
  • Hong Kong VPS
  • US VPS
Dedicated Servers
  • Hong Kong Servers
  • US Servers
  • Singapore Servers
  • Japan Servers
More
  • Contact Us
  • Blog
  • Legal
© 2026 Server.HK | Hosting Limited, Hong Kong | Company Registration No. 77008912
Telegram
Telegram @ServerHKBot